CVE-2025-38706
published 2025-09-04CVE-2025-38706: In the Linux kernel, the following vulnerability has been resolved: ASoC: core: Check for rtd == NULL in snd_soc_remove_pcm_runtime()…
medium5.5CVSS 3.1
AVLACLPRLUINSUCNINAH
In the Linux kernel, the following vulnerability has been resolved:
ASoC: core: Check for rtd == NULL in snd_soc_remove_pcm_runtime()
snd_soc_remove_pcm_runtime() might be called with rtd == NULL which will
leads to null pointer dereference.
This was reproduced with topology loading and marking a link as ignore
due to missing hardware component on the system.
On module removal the soc_tplg_remove_link() would call
snd_soc_remove_pcm_runtime() with rtd == NULL since the link was ignored,
no runtime was created.
Affected
36 ranges· showing 25
| Vendor | Product | Version range | Fixed in |
|---|---|---|---|
| debian | debian_linux | — | — |
| debian | linux | < linux 6.1.153-1 (bookworm) | linux 6.1.153-1 (bookworm) |
| debian | linux-6.1 | < linux 6.1.153-1 (bookworm) | linux 6.1.153-1 (bookworm) |
| linux | linux | — | — |
| linux | linux | >= 50cd9b5317d5593d0a33f4227f56ddcc1bf66604 < 8b465bedc2b417fd27c1d1ab7122882b4b60b1a0 | 8b465bedc2b417fd27c1d1ab7122882b4b60b1a0 |
| linux | linux | >= 50cd9b5317d5593d0a33f4227f56ddcc1bf66604 < 82ba7b8cf9f6e3bf392a9f08ba3d1c0b200ccb94 | 82ba7b8cf9f6e3bf392a9f08ba3d1c0b200ccb94 |
| linux | linux | >= 50cd9b5317d5593d0a33f4227f56ddcc1bf66604 < 7f8fc03712194fd4e2df28af7f7f7a38205934ef | 7f8fc03712194fd4e2df28af7f7f7a38205934ef |
| linux | linux | >= 50cd9b5317d5593d0a33f4227f56ddcc1bf66604 < 41f53afe53a57a7c50323f99424b598190acf192 | 41f53afe53a57a7c50323f99424b598190acf192 |
| linux | linux | >= 50cd9b5317d5593d0a33f4227f56ddcc1bf66604 < 2fce20decc6a83f16dd73744150c4e7ea6c97c21 | 2fce20decc6a83f16dd73744150c4e7ea6c97c21 |
| linux | linux | >= 50cd9b5317d5593d0a33f4227f56ddcc1bf66604 < cecc65827ef3df9754e097582d89569139e6cd1e | cecc65827ef3df9754e097582d89569139e6cd1e |
| linux | linux | >= 50cd9b5317d5593d0a33f4227f56ddcc1bf66604 < 7ce0a7255ce97ed7c54afae83fdbce712a1f0c9e | 7ce0a7255ce97ed7c54afae83fdbce712a1f0c9e |
| linux | linux | >= 50cd9b5317d5593d0a33f4227f56ddcc1bf66604 < 2d91cb261cac6d885954b8f5da28b5c176c18131 | 2d91cb261cac6d885954b8f5da28b5c176c18131 |
| linux | linux_kernel | >= 0 < 5.10.244-1 | 5.10.244-1 |
| linux | linux_kernel | >= 0 < 6.1.153-1 | 6.1.153-1 |
| linux | linux_kernel | >= 0 < 6.12.43-1 | 6.12.43-1 |
| linux | linux_kernel | >= 0 < 6.16.3-1 | 6.16.3-1 |
| linux | linux_kernel | >= 0 < 5.15.0-163.173 | 5.15.0-163.173 |
| linux | linux_kernel | >= 0 < 6.8.0-100.100 | 6.8.0-100.100 |
| linux | linux_kernel | >= 5.11 < 5.15.190 | 5.15.190 |
| linux | linux_kernel | >= 5.16 < 6.1.149 | 6.1.149 |
| linux | linux_kernel | >= 5.6 < 5.10.241 | 5.10.241 |
| linux | linux_kernel | >= 6.13 < 6.15.11 | 6.15.11 |
| linux | linux_kernel | >= 6.16 < 6.16.2 | 6.16.2 |
| linux | linux_kernel | >= 6.2 < 6.6.103 | 6.6.103 |
| linux | linux_kernel | >= 6.7 < 6.12.43 | 6.12.43 |
CVSS provenance
nvdv3.15.5MEDIUMCVSS:3.1/AV:L/AC:L/PR:L/UI:N/S:U/C:N/I:N/A:H
osv5.5MEDIUM